Every year, Social Enterprise Day is a chance to come together and celebrate the organisations and individuals using business as a force for good. Here in the North East, it has become a space where changemakers can connect, recharge, and think bigger about what’s possible.

And we’re really pleased to share that it’s back for 2026.

This year we’re focusing on something many social entrepreneurs tell us they struggle with; not just surviving, but finding ways to truly thrive. Nationally, only around one in three businesses make it to their fifth birthday, and our own review of North East CIC data shows survival rates in the North East are much the same. Too many organisations risk burning out before their impact has time to take root.

At the same time, much of the support available is designed either for very new start-ups or for fast-growing enterprises. That leaves a gap in the middle, where most social enterprises sit; working day in, day out to deliver impact, but perhaps without the right support to build resilience for the long term.

That’s why this year’s theme is... Change in Action

In a world full of big challenges, we aren’t trying to solve everything at once. Instead, we’re focusing on purposeful, values-driven action, building sustainable foundations, and protecting the wellbeing of our leaders.

From Civil Service to leading a charity breaking cycles of domestic abuse 💙

A brand new episode of Chats with Changemakers is out today. 🎧

In this episode, Kate Duffy speaks with Catherine Marchant, CEO of Impact Family Services, a charity supporting adults, children and young people affected by domestic abuse across local communities.

What began as a short-term role in the charity sector became a long-term mission for Catherine, focused on prevention, early intervention, and helping families rebuild and break cycles of abuse.

In this episode, Catherine shares:

🩵 Her journey from the Civil Service into charity leadership

🩵 Why breaking the cycle of domestic abuse takes prevention, education and long-term support

🩵 The realities of leading a small charity in a challenging funding landscape

🩵 How income diversification and partnerships help sustain vital community services

🩵 The importance of workplace support and training around domestic abuse

🩵 Lessons learned about leadership, resilience, and listening to yourself

This is a powerful and honest conversation about leadership, community impact, and the life-changing work happening within small charities every day.

Our fully funded Business with Purpose Accelerator is designed to help you turn an early-stage idea into a clear, actionable plan, with structured support at every stage 🩵

You’ll start with a 1:1 Zoom diagnostic session to explore your idea, refine your thinking, and identify your next steps.

The 1-day in-person Accelerator (with lunch included) is a practical, hands-on workshop where you’ll test and shape your idea, build business planning skills, explore social enterprise structures, and leave with a personalised action plan.

After the programme, you’ll join weekly online mastermind sessions to help you stay focused and keep momentum, along with peer support from others on a similar journey.

When you’re ready, you’ll also have access to 1:1 coaching to support you in developing or registering your business.

In this episode of Chats with Changemakers, host Kate Duffy spoke with Warren Milburn, founder of The Million People Project, a bold social enterprise working to tackle digital poverty by refurbishing and redistributing laptops to people who need them most.

Warren reflects on the scale of the challenge, the reality of building momentum over time, and the importance of continuing to grow the project through new partnerships, including international work now expanding into South Africa.
